basicthinker Goto Github PK
Name: Jinglei Ren
Type: User
Company: Merico
Bio: Founder at Merico / Apache DevLake / DevChat
Location: Beijing & San Francisco
Blog: https://persper.org
Name: Jinglei Ren
Type: User
Company: Merico
Bio: Founder at Merico / Apache DevLake / DevChat
Location: Beijing & San Francisco
Blog: https://persper.org
Merico Build is a web app empowering open source developers, maintainers, and communities with metrics from Git, GitHub, and more.
A red-black tree based cache for read/write operations.
A delta encoding tool for Project Cinquain. Implementation of the Karp-Rabin/Rabin fingerprint algorithm tailored for a sliding window + a linear-time and constant-space delta-encoding algorithm.
The metadata components of Cinquain filesystem.
A highly efficient key-value store that supports arbitrarily large values and parallel byte-range access to data. Based on Redis.
A series of compilers engineered under the object-oriented perspective with high extensibility. The previous part of this project has been adopted into the book "Object-Oriented Design and Development of the C0 Interpreter (C++ Edition)" published by Tsinghua University Press.
A fast RDMA library in C++
libpaxos-cpp is a C++ implementation of the Paxos distributed consensus protocol
A persistent transactional memory library
PreAngel Home, Portfolio Directory, and News Updates.
Persper Transactional Memory Compiler (PTMC), derived from DTMC (http://www.velox-project.eu/software/dtmc).
Multi-return RPC, a new programming primitive for distributed systems
Application case of Quatrain: the core management component of a practical multi-site data sharing platform.
Application case of Quatrain: the data aggregation component of a mashup of Google Earth & Flickr
Analyser of Quatrain's logs.
Modifications to Hadoop Online Prototype (HOP: http://code.google.com/p/hop) as an application of Quatrain.
A prototype file system used to record application writes + Analysis of logs to demonstrate deduplication/compression effects
An extensible C++ lib for remote direct memory access, RDMA.
Redis is an in-memory database that persists on disk. The data model is key-value, but many different kind of values are supported: Strings, Lists, Sets, Sorted Sets, Hashes
Check out all e-conomic Developer Network resources at http://www.e-conomic.com/developer
Scripts for running experiments.
A smartphone filesystem that provides consistency-guaranteed memory-class performance and optimized app write energy efficiency.
Benchmarks that simulate user operations on several smartphone apps (Android).
An extensible trace analyser for Project Sestet. Simple multi-round streaming.
A cache auxiliary to control write-backs, integrated with gem5.
A simple but optimized Pin tool (Pintool) to collect memory access trace. Records are buffered and compressed before being outputted to a compact binary file.
A simulator of a memory controller designed for hybrid DRAM+NVM.
Multicore in-memory storage engine
DevStream: the open-source DevOps toolchain manager (DTM).
LaTeX Thesis Template for Tsinghua University
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.